Baseball Preview: Molokai Farmers vs. Seabury Hall Spartans

Molokai is 8-2 against Seabury Hall since April of 2019, and they'll have a chance to extend that success on Friday. The Molokai Farmers are on the road again to play the Seabury Hall Spartans at 1:00 p.m. Both teams come into the contest bolstered by wins in their previous matches.

Molokai stacked a fifth blowout win onto their ever-increasing hoard last Saturday. They put the hurt on Lanai with a sharp 11-5 win.

Meanwhile, Seabury Hall was able to grind out a solid victory over Lanai on Saturday, taking the game 7-2. The win made it back-to-back victories for Seabury Hall.

Asher Halick and Kayden "Bob" Volner made a splash no matter where they played. On the mound, Halick tossed two innings while giving up no earned run or hits (he also didn't allow any walks). Meanwhile, Volner pitched five innings while giving up just one earned run off three hits. At the plate, Halick scored a run while going 2-for-3, while Volner scored two runs and stole two bases while going 2-for-3.

In other batting news, Murray Brown V was excellent, going 2-for-4 with a stolen base, two RBI, and a double. Another player making a difference was Ha?alohi Dancil, who scored a run and stole a base while going 2-for-3.

Molokai pushed their record up to 8-0 with that win, which was their fourth straight on the road. As for Seabury Hall, their record is now 5-2.

Molokai was able to grind out a solid victory over Seabury Hall in their previous meeting back in March, winning 11-8. The rematch might be a little tougher for Molokai since the team won't have the home-field advantage this time around. We'll see if the change in venue makes a difference.
